Agree with Riley, it depends upon province you are interested to set-up your business.
But the rough estimate in initial franchise fee for most fast-food franchises is approx. $40,000+ for popular brands like McDonald's, Subway, Pinkberry, Wendy's etc.

In my opinion, if you are willing to spend around $20,000+ then first set-up your own fast-food cafeteria to get to know the business possibilities in the area/province. Most fast-food franchises in Canada close down with 5 years after set-up due to significant losses. Kindly research a bit and then invest.
